ASi is an internationally standardized industrial wiring system (EN 50295, IEC 62026-2) with over 32 million active modules installed and over 1800 certified products. The user organization, which embraces 350 member companies, ensures full compatibility of all products.

Wiring

AS-Interface is an industrial networking solution for automation systems. It is designed for connecting simple field I/O devices such as binary ON/OFF, analog and safety I/O devices according to EN 50295, IEC 62023-2. Using only a two conductor profile or round cable (ASi cable, 2 x 1.5 mm2, 16 AWG) to connect all ASi modules to the master using a free topology. This is the main advantage of this system compared to conventional, parallel wiring, where every single signal has to be wired directly to the control system. Data and power are available in the same ASi cable. Every ASi node or module has its own address for accessing its data. The modules can be addressed from 1 to 31 (single address), or, with extended addressing, there are 62 nodes available (1A to 31A and 1B to 31B). Single adresses and modules with extended addressing (AB modules) can share the same network.

Free Topology

ASi supports free topology such as Ring, Linear and Star network.

High availability and safety in accordance with SIL – problem free

AS-Interface also enables safety-relevant systems (EN ISO 13849) to be equipped with interference protection. High-availability or redundant systems (even with circuit integrity) and systems with special safety requirements, such as SIL1, SIL2 or SIL3, all fall under the application spectrum of ASi. The cabling route and communication with all participants are constantly monitored, even in the standard version. This ensures that all dampers can be still controlled in the event of a fire.

Profile and round cable

It is possible to use a specific cable for various applications. For instance, the profile cable with polarity reversal protection is suitable for fire dampers. It is halogen-free and available in 1.5 mm2 or 2.5 mm2. However, it may also be possible to use a pre-laid round cable, such as NYM 2 × 1.5 mm2 or NYM 2 × 2.5 mm2. In terms of smoke extraction, cables with circuit integrity (e.g. E90) are often necessary.

Connection

The connection to fire protection or smoke extraction dampers is usually pre-wired and ready to plug in to the AMP plugs of the drives. If the drives come with connecting wires, it is also possible to terminate the cables with push-in spring-type terminals.

Software

Commissioning / Diagnostic / Software / Test Run

The ASi masters can transfer all data to a higher level control or process them locally depending on the application and their requirements. In terms of local processing, they offer maximum flexibility, and they are freely programmable or provided complete with a pre-installed program for many application scenarios: connect - ready. Of course, all state information and diagnostic messages from the building control system are always available. An integrated web server enables remote diagnostics even from computers without diagnostics software.

 

The comprehensive package is rounded off by comfortable tools for commissioning, diagnostics and test runs.
